Sep 9, 2021 · At first glance, writing a memoir might seem straightforward. After all, aren’t memoirs just a collection of stories from your own life? The reality is that memoir writing is a delicate process, and though the stories are unique, many of the best memoirs contain certain key elements that make them effective.

A memoir focuses on just one story from your life and aims to establish an emotional connection with the reader. You don’t need to write your whole life story from beginning to end in a memoir, just the parts that pertain to the story you are trying to tell. However, if your memoir is intended to serve as an inspiration for ...The Braided Approach to Memoir. Our lives are made up of many strands—some of experience, some of memory, some of meditation and reflection, some of ongoing action. Those who write memoir must find the appropriate forms for ensuring that the textures of life will have their full expression.
